Four Cities Capital

FourCities Capital is a venture capital firm located in Newton, Massachusetts, focused on investing in the healthcare and technology sectors. The firm believes that the influence of technology and software on the global economy is still in its nascent stages, presenting significant opportunities for growth and innovation. By targeting these key industries, FourCities Capital aims to support the development of transformative solutions that can enhance healthcare delivery and drive technological advancements.
